I really love the Compendium description for this one. ‘It packs quite a wallop.’ What it doesn’t mention is the poor durability. I like talking about that one time I killed a Molduga with a soup ladle, but in reality it was just the last few blows: the rest was done with the Master Sword because a soup ladle only does four hit points of damage and doesn’t last long enough to make up for it.

This image was taken at Wetland Stable in the far western reaches of Lanayru.
